sociology 1301 with correct answer 2025




antipositivism - CORRECT ANSWER-the view that social researchers should strive for
subjectivity as they worked to represent social processes, cultural norms, and societal
values

Conflict Theory - CORRECT ANSWER-a theory that looks at society as a competition
for limited resources

Constructivism - CORRECT ANSWER-an extension of symbolic interaction theory
which proposes that reality is what humans cognitively construct it to be

dramaturgical analysis - CORRECT ANSWER-a technique sociologists use in which
they view society through the metaphor of theatrical performance

dynamic equilibrium - CORRECT ANSWER-a stable state in which all parts of a healthy
society work together properly

Dysfunstion - CORRECT ANSWER-social patterns that have undesirable
consequences for the operation of society

figuration - CORRECT ANSWER-the process of simultaneously analyzing the behavior
of individuals and the society that shapes that behavior

function - CORRECT ANSWER-the part a recurrent activity plays in the social life as a
whole and the contribution it makes to structural continuity

Functionalism - CORRECT ANSWER-a theoretical approach that sees society as a
structure with interrelated parts designed to meet the biological and social needs of
individuals that make up that society

generalized others - CORRECT ANSWER-the organized and generalized attitude of a
social group

grand theories - CORRECT ANSWER-an attempt to explain large-scale relationships
and answer fundamental questions such as why societies form and why they change

Hypothesis - CORRECT ANSWER-A testable prediction, often implied by a theory

, latent functions - CORRECT ANSWER-the unrecognized and unintended
consequences of any social pattern

macro level - CORRECT ANSWER-a wide-scale view of the role of social structures
within a society

manifest functions - CORRECT ANSWER-sought consequences of a social process

micro-level theories - CORRECT ANSWER-the study of specific relationships between
individuals or small groups

Paradigms - CORRECT ANSWER-philosophical and theoretical frameworks used within
a discipline to formulate theories, generalizations, and the experiments performed in
support of them

Positivism - CORRECT ANSWER-the scientific study of social patterns

qualitive sociology - CORRECT ANSWER-in-depth interview, focus groups and analysis
of content sources as the source of its data

quantitive sociology - CORRECT ANSWER-uses statistical methods such as surveys
with large numbers of participants

Reification - CORRECT ANSWER-an error of treating an abstract concept as though it
has a real, material existence

significant others - CORRECT ANSWER-specific individuals that impact a person's life

social facts - CORRECT ANSWER-the laws, morals, values, religious beliefs, customs,
fashions, rituals, and all of the cultural rules that govern social life

social institutions - CORRECT ANSWER-patterns of beliefs and behaviors focused on
meeting social needs

social solidarity - CORRECT ANSWER-the social ties that bind a group of people
together such as kinship, shared location, and religion

society - CORRECT ANSWER-a group of people who live in a defined geographical
area who interact with one another and who share a common culture

sociological imagination - CORRECT ANSWER-the ability to understand how your own
past relates to that of other people such as history in general and societal structures in
particular.
